Exclusive – Whelan tells Arsenal: ‘You’re next in Wigan’s FA Cup run’

Wigan owner Dave Whelan has fired a warning shot at Arsenal fans who think his club will be a pushover in the FA Cup semi-finals.
Gunners fans were rejoicing when the Latics stunningly beat Manchester City 2-1 at the Etihad to set up a last-four clash at Wembley Stadium.
But Whelan told talkSPORT thinking Wigan will be easy pickings is precisely what the Blues thought today and in last year's shock FA Cup final win.
"Last year Manchester City said, 'We’re in the final and they’re glad to be playing Wigan because they thought they would win it'. Today they were glad they were playing Wigan and not Arsenal or Everton to get to the semi-finals," he told Call Collymore.
"But we come here and we’ve won 2-1. So Arsenal you can be proud and you can be confident but we will give you a game."
The Championship club are chasing promotion back to the Premier League at the first time of asking and are only outside the play-offs on goal difference.
The priority for us is to get in the play-offs, win and get back in the Premier League. That is the total priority," Whelan added.
"The Fa Cup is something that we’ve got and to retain it and go and win it two years in a row is very rarely done. But we’re in the semi-finals, we’re back at Wembley, we’re all so proud and what I’m saying to our manager is, ‘you’ve done a super job’ and all the crowd today love that guy."
